Sailang Population - Chamoli, Uttarakhand

Sailang is a medium size village located in Joshimath Tehsil of Chamoli district, Uttarakhand with total 150 families residing. The Sailang village has population of 761 of which 416 are males while 345 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Sailang village population of children with age 0-6 is 109 which makes up 14.32 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Sailang village is 829 which is lower than Uttarakhand state average of 963. Child Sex Ratio for the Sailang as per census is 912, higher than Uttarakhand average of 890.

Sailang village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ttarakh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Sailang village was 83.13 % compared to 78.82 % of Uttarakhand. In Sailang Male literacy stands at 92.48 % while female literacy rate was 71.67 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 11.30 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 1.71 % of total population in Sailang village.

Work Profile

In Sailang village out of total population, 459 were engaged in work activities. 91.94 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 8.06 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 459 workers engaged in Main Work, 296 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 2 were Agricultural labourer.
